Job Description SummaryThis is a senior leadership role within the Marine business unit of GE Power Conversion UK Ltd. The Senior Project Manager will provide project co-ordination for a strategic, long-term programme of national importance. This role will support the Programme Director, and will be involved in delivery, governance, and customer engagement, ensuring commercial success and operational excellence across multiple integrated workstreams.
The position requires experience in leading complex programmes within highly regulated environments, with the ability to operate at both strategic and operational levels.

Job Description

The Senior Project Manager will:

  • Co-ordinate the deliveries from the work package teams, and support the Programme Director in the delivery of this critical programme central to the UK Marine business, with direct impact on GE Vernova’s long-term customer relationships and growth strategy.
  • Support the Programme Director in leading and influencing a multi-disciplinary team, including indirect leadership of multiple project managers and functional leads, to ensure delivery of programme milestones.
  • Support programme governance, establishing and maintaining control across financial, technical, commercial, and quality dimensions.
  • Drive programme execution through structured reviews, ensuring early identification and mitigation of risks, proactive management of change, and robust forecasting of financial and operational performance.
  • Support the Programme Director in negotiations with customers, partners, and suppliers on contractual, commercial, and delivery matters.
  • Ensure compliance with GE processes, business standards, and regulatory obligations at all times.
  • Report progress, risks, and outcomes to Programme Director and senior leadership within GE Vernova, providing clear insight into programme status and strategic implications.

Essential Skills and Qualifications

  • Degree (or equivalent) in Engineering, Business, or Project/Programme Management discipline.
  • Experience in programme management, including experience of large-scale, multi-year programmes in a customer-facing capacity.
  • Demonstrated ability to maintain strong execution discipline.
  • Experience of working in high-performing teams within complex, matrix organisations.
  • Strong financial acumen with the ability to manage and critique programme P&L, cashflow, and commercial models.
  • Experience negotiating and managing complex customer contracts and supplier agreements.
  • UK nationals only (dual nationality not permitted due to programme requirements).
  • Full UK driving licence.
  • Ability to achieve and maintain SC clearance (with potential for higher clearance depending on programme requirements).
  • Willingness to travel domestically and internationally to customer, supplier, and GE sites as required.

Desired Characteristics

  • Strategic thinker with ability to align programme delivery to long-term business objectives.
  • Strong leadership presence, able to influence and inspire at all organisational levels.
  • Decisive, resilient, and solutions-focused in managing ambiguity and change.
  • Skilled negotiator and relationship builder across government, defence, and commercial stakeholders.

What We Do

GE Vernova is a planned purpose-built company on a mission to electrify the planet while simultaneously working to decarbonize it.

If we want our energy future to be different…we must be different.

Our mission is embedded in our name. We retain our treasured legacy, “GE,” in our name as an enduring and hard-earned badge of quality and ingenuity. “Ver” / “verde” signal Earth’s verdant and lush ecosystems. “Nova,” from the Latin “novus,” nods to a new, innovative era of lower carbon energy that GE Vernova will help deliver.

GE Vernova brings together GE’s portfolio of energy businesses including Power, Wind, Electrification and Digital businesses. With focus, GE Vernova is accelerating the path to more reliable, affordable, and sustainable energy, while helping our customers power economies and deliver the electricity that is vital to health, safety, security, and improved quality of life.
